'Drama saved my life': how performing can help mental health problems

May Contain Nuts is an award-winning theatre company of people with experience of mental ill health

Kerry Shadbolt feared for her life as she approached the end of two years of drama therapy, provided by the NHS to help her manage her emotionally unstable personality disorder. Shadbolt, 47, had formed close friendships within her group and it was a place where she felt she could be herself. It was also sometimes the only thing she could leave her house for.
